out of curiosity why go from clomid straight to IVF???
that's like going from the bunny trail to the black diamond with no stops in between.
unless your issue is MF in which case it makes sense.

Posted 2/2/11 6:31 PM
 

bookworm
Two Little Rosebuds

Member since 8/09

2106 total posts

Name:

Re: next move: IVF

Posted by FlowerWife

out of curiosity why go from clomid straight to IVF???
that's like going from the bunny trail to the black diamond with no stops in between.
unless your issue is MF in which case it makes sense.



he said based on my age and how well i responded to clomid, he predicted i'd make like 10-15 follies on injectables, which he said is just dangerous when you're injecting sperm into the uterus with no control. and as it turns out, we do have MF issues. DH's counts have dropped steadily since the first IUI, and last time he was down to 4.5m after the wash, which is just under what they want for the IUI. he also has morphology issues, so he said that IUI doesn't really help with that because the head is not shaped the way it needs to be to penetrate the egg. given that we have good insurance coverage, he thought it was the best way to go.
